Seeking Justice for Sexual Abuse & Sexual Assault at Youth Treatment Centers

One only needs to look at a recent case of sexual abuse at a Toquerville youth treatment center to understand the severity of the issue.

Paul Anthony Nichols, a 23-year-old former employee at a youth treatment center in Toquerville, was recently sentenced on multiple felony charges in the 5th District Court.

Nichols faced seven second-degree felony charges, including five counts of forcible sexual abuse and two counts of sexual exploitation of a minor.

He had pleaded guilty to these charges. As part of the plea deal, a first-degree felony rape charge against him was dropped.

The prosecution argued for a prison sentence due to the severity of the charges; the betrayal of trust inherent in Nichols' role as a counselor, and the victims were already vulnerable, being in a treatment facility.

New Mexico Jury Awards $485M in Sexual Assault Lawsuit

The jury awarded $80 million in compensatory damages for the young girl and a $400 million in punitive damages against Acadia Healthcare Company Inc., FamilyWorks, Desert Hills, and Youth and Family Centered Services of New Mexico Inc.

The jury also awarded $5 million in punitive damages against Clarence Garcia.

Acadia Healthcare® is considered one of the largest independent providers of behavioral health services in the U.S., with a network of 250 facilities across 39 states and Puerto Rico.
